Looking for warm weather? Then head to Jangheung in August, when the average temperature is 25 °C, and the highest can go up to 30 °C. The coldest month, on the other hand, is January, when it can get as cold as -4 °C, with an average temperature of 0 °C. You’re likely to see more rain in August, when precipitation is around 276 mm. In contrast, December is usually the driest month of the year in Jangheung, with an average rainfall of 24 mm.
